Ratings: Broadcast Finals for March 7, 2013

THE BIG BANG THEORY is the nights top show with 17.6 million viewers and a strong 5.5 rating in Adults 18-49. It easily beat AMERICAN IDOL during the half hour, but it also helped lead out TWO AND A HALF MEN win its half hour (13.5 million viewers, 3.9 demo), also beating AMERICAN IDOL.  It is the first time MEN topped IDOL in the ratings.

Not all new was bad for FOX, GLEE actually perked up after a two week layoff. The veteran dramedy drew 6.7 million viewers and posted a 2.4 demo rating. That is up by more than 1.5 million viewers and a 41% increase from it's last episode. It is the series best numbers since December 6th.

NBC continued the burn off of COMMUNITY and 1600 PENN as neither show reached 3.5 million viewers.

ELEMENTARY won the battle of repeat dramas at 10 p.m., with 8.7 million viewers and a 1.6 demo rating.

For the Night:
CBS - 12.9 million viewers, 3.0 rating in Adults 18-49
FOX - 7.9 million viewers, 3.1 rating in Adults 18-49
ABC - 3.9 million viewers, 1.1 rating in Adults 18-49
NBC - 3.0 million viewers, 1.1 rating in Adults 18-49
CW - 0.9 million viewers, 0.4 rating in Adults 18-49
